What’s Next for the Wrecking Ball in Greenwich? Former Griffin & Howe Building

A Demolition sign recently went up at the former home of Griffin and Howe retail gun store at 340 West Putnam Ave next door to the Maserati dealership. The building was originally a residence and was built in 1923.  Griffin & Howe has a long history of manufacturing guns.

Griffin & Howe was founded in New York City in 1923. In 1999 it opened the retail store in Greenwich in the two-story Colonial building that was once a residential property.

On Dec. 15, 2014 the property was told to Miller Partners LLC for $1,000,000.

Miller Partners LLC has a business address of 342 West Putnam Ave. The name of the principal is Richard S. Kippelman, Manger. The agent is John P Tesei.
